New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Offloading large workflows raises db syntax errors that prevent the offloading #12946
Comments
You're on a pretty old version, so I would suggest trying with |
Looking at the diff v3.4.6..v3.4.16, #10887 in particular seems related (although the error is different) |
I’ll be able to test the “:latest” by Sunday but what other information can I provide you with? |
This issue has been automatically marked as stale because it has not had recent activity and needs more information. It will be closed if no further activity occurs. |
This issue has been closed due to inactivity and lack of information. If you still encounter this issue, please add the requested information and re-open. |
Pre-requisites
:latest
What happened/what did you expect to happen?
I have tried to enable
nodeStatusOffload
for the workflow-controller, and configured the postgresql under the persistence section in the workflow-controller-configuration.The connection is successful, as there're migration logs in the controller.
But when it reaches the offloading part, it crashes with this error:
I also tried doing this with mysql instead of postgresql but got another syntax error:
I am trying to make my Argo Server run very large workflows, and to do so I generated a sample DAG with demo steps that simply print, and tried to run 700 of those without any dependency between the tasks.
Version
v3.4.6
Paste a small workflow that reproduces the issue. We must be able to run the workflow; don't enter a workflows that uses private images.
Logs from the workflow controller
Logs from in your workflow's wait container
The text was updated successfully, but these errors were encountered: